高分毕设分享:Springboot+Vue共享汽车管理系统源码

版权申诉
0 下载量 150 浏览量 更新于2024-10-05 收藏 8.26MB ZIP 举报
资源摘要信息:"本项目为基于Spring Boot和Vue的共享汽车管理系统源码,是一份高分毕业设计作品,适合需要实战练习的计算机专业学生,亦可作为课程设计和期末大作业使用。系统前后端分离,前端采用Vue.js框架,后端采用Spring Boot框架,代码质量经过严格调试,无明显bug,具备良好的参考和使用价值。 技术栈知识点: 1. Spring Boot:是一个基于Spring的一个开源框架,主要目的是简化Spring应用的初始搭建以及开发过程。它提供了独立的、产品级别的基于Spring框架的应用。使用Spring Boot可以轻松创建独立的、生产级别的Spring应用,它使用“约定优于配置”的原则,大量减少了项目中的配置工作。 2. Vue.js:是一套构建用户界面的渐进式JavaScript框架。与其他大型框架不同的是,Vue被设计为可以自底向上增量开发。核心库只关注视图层,易于上手,同时也可以与其他库或现有项目整合。 3. 前后端分离:指前端开发和后端开发分离,前端通常使用HTML、CSS和JavaScript等技术来构建用户界面,而后端则通常使用Java、Python、Node.js等后端语言编写业务逻辑、数据库交互等。前后端分离使得开发更加模块化,便于维护和扩展。 项目源码文件结构知识点: 1. mvnw.cmd:Maven的Windows命令行脚本文件,用于在Windows环境下运行Maven命令。 2. 必读推荐.docx:文档文件,包含了对该项目使用的推荐说明和注意事项,用户在开始使用前应当阅读此文档。 3. .classpath:此文件是Eclipse IDE项目文件,包含了项目中类路径的配置信息,便于在Eclipse中正确加载项目。 4. pom.xml:Maven项目对象模型文件,定义了项目的构建配置、依赖关系、插件等信息。 5. src:包含项目源代码的目录,分为前端和后端目录,前端通常存放在src/main/webapp目录下,后端则在src/main/java目录下。 6. .mvn:Maven的项目目录,包含Maven运行时的一些相关配置和文件。 7. 配置说明.pdf:文档文件,提供了详细的项目配置说明,帮助用户了解如何配置数据库、服务端口等项目运行必要的参数。 8. target:Maven构建的目标目录,存放编译后的字节码文件(.class)、打包后的jar或war文件等。 9. .factorypath:Eclipse工厂路径配置文件,用于配置项目中的工厂路径。 10. pom-war.xml:是Maven的项目对象模型文件,用于定义Web应用程序的构建配置,尤其是war打包的相关配置。 在了解了以上技术栈和文件结构后,该项目将有助于学习者深入理解前后端分离的开发模式,掌握Spring Boot和Vue.js框架的使用,同时能够通过实际项目的代码来加深对软件开发流程的理解,包括源码组织、构建配置、环境搭建等方面的知识。对于即将面临毕业设计的计算机专业学生来说,这是一个非常实用的参考资料。"